You can replace a traditional key at a local hardware store or locksmith. These keys are significantly cheaper than those that have a transponder chip and they do not require any programming or encoding to work. Smart key repairs or reprogrammings can only be performed by experts and may take an hour.

The cost to replace the car key repairs key is different dependent on the type of key, the locksmith that you choose, and whether your vehicle needs programming. The replacement of a traditional key typically costs around $10, but it can be higher for more advanced keys that require encoding in order to sync with your vehicle's computer. This process could take a few hours or more, and it may require a trip to the dealership if the locksmith doesn't have this kind of equipment on hand.
